Session on Demonstration of Extraction and Application of Natural Dye
The Dr. APJ Abdul Kalam Science Society organised an event titled “Hands-on Demonstration on Extraction and Application of Natural Dye”, conducted by the students of SOAS. The insightful session focused on preparing fabric dyes and food colours using natural resources, providing students with practical experience in sustainable practices. The session began with an introduction to the significance of natural dyes, followed by demonstrations of extracting different colours from various natural sources. Students explored the use of hibiscus, turmeric, beetroot, purple cabbage, and spinach to produce food colours. For fabric dyeing, a broader range of materials was used, including turmeric, beetroot, purple cabbage, spinach, coffee, bougainvillaea, henna, tea leaves, jaggery, red sand, and roselle flowers. This hands-on approach allowed participants to explore the vibrant possibilities of natural dyes while fostering an appreciation for eco-friendly alternatives in the food and textile industries.
